Factors Affecting Cost
- Size of Driveway Pad: Larger pads require more materials and labor.
- Material Choice: Concrete, asphalt, and pavers vary in price.
- Labor Costs: Local labor rates can affect the total expense.
- Site Preparation: Grading, excavation, and removal of old materials add to costs.
- Permits and Inspections: Required permits and inspection fees can vary.
- Complexity of Design: Custom designs and patterns may increase costs.
- Weather Conditions: Seasonal weather can impact installation timelines and costs.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(USD) |
---|---|
Concrete Driveway Pad | $3,500 - $7,000 |
Asphalt Driveway Pad | $2,500 - $5,000 |
Paver Driveway Pad | $5,000 - $10,000 |
Site Preparation |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Grading and Excavation | $800 - $2,500 |
Permit Fees | $100 - $500 |
Custom Design and Patterns | $1,000 - $4,000 |
